Key Factors to Think About When Selecting a Professional for Your Roof covering Selecting the appropriate expert for a roofing job includes careful consideration of a number of essential factors. Experience with different roof covering products is crucial, as is a strong track record backed by customer reviews. Licensing and https://roofrepair45554.xzblogs.com/76593727/the-evolution-of-metal-roofing-and-how-roofing-pleasant-hill-mo-experts-adapted